Understanding Affiliate Marketing

Affiliate marketing is a performance-based business model where you earn a commission for promoting products or services offered by others. Essentially, you act as a middleman between the merchant and the consumer. When someone clicks on your affiliate link and makes a purchase, you earn a percentage of the sale.

The Key Players in Affiliate Marketing

  • Merchants: The companies or individuals offering products for sale.
  • Affiliates: Individuals (like you) who promote the products through affiliate links.
  • Consumers: The end-users who make purchases through your links.
  • Affiliate Networks: Platforms that connect affiliates with merchants (e.g., ShareASale, CJ Affiliate, Amazon Associates).

Selecting the Right Niche

Before diving into affiliate marketing, it’s crucial to select a niche that aligns with your interests and expertise. The right niche can significantly impact your earnings. Here are some tips for choosing a niche:

Parameters to Consider

  1. Passion: Choose a niche you are passionate about. This will make content creation enjoyable and maintain your motivation in the long run.
  2. Market Demand: Research the market demand for your chosen niche. Tools like Google Trends can help you identify trending topics.
  3. Competition: Analyze the level of competition in your niche. Moderate competition is often ideal, as it indicates interest but also potential opportunities.
  4. Monetization Potential: Ensure there are affiliate programs related to your niche that offer decent commissions.

Popular Affiliate Programs to Consider

Program Commission Rate Cookie Duration
Amazon Associates 1% – 10% 24 hours
ShareASale Varies by merchant Varies
Rakuten Marketing Varies Varies
ClickBank 50% – 75% 60 days

Tracking and Analyzing Performance

To ensure your affiliate marketing efforts are paying off, regularly track and analyze your performance. Most affiliate programs provide dashboards where you can view your earnings, clicks, and conversions.

Key Metrics to Monitor

  • Clicks: The number of times users have clicked on your affiliate links.
  • Conversions: The number of sales or actions taken by users after clicking your link.
  • Earnings per Click (EPC): A metric indicating how much you earn on average for each click.

Adjusting Your Strategy

Using the data collected, adjust your strategies as needed. A/B testing different types of content, headlines, and promotional strategies can help you find what works best for your audience.

What are affiliate links?

Affiliate links are special URLs that contain a tracking code, allowing companies to track sales or traffic generated by an affiliate’s marketing efforts.
